TCP/IP协议详解:TCP连接与子网规划
需积分: 9 177 浏览量
更新于2024-07-10
收藏 589KB PPT 举报
"TCP连接-HL-002 TCP-IP原理和子网规划(v4.0-20031226)"
在TCP/IP协议中,TCP(Transmission Control Protocol)是一种面向连接的、可靠的传输层协议,它确保了数据在网络中的正确传输。TCP通过三次握手建立连接,这个过程在提供的描述中有所体现。当客户端(client)想要与服务器(server)建立连接时,它首先发送一个SYN(同步)报文段,其中包含一个随机序列号a。服务器收到这个请求后,回应一个SYN报文段,同时确认客户端的序列号(ack=a+1),并附带自己的序列号b。最后,客户端再发送一个SYN报文段,确认服务器的序列号(ack=b+1),同时自己的序列号变为a+1。这样,双方都确认了对方的序列号,连接建立成功。
TCP/IP协议栈是互联网的基础,其分层结构包括应用层、传输层、网络层和数据链路层。应用层是最高层,提供了如HTTP、FTP、SMTP等服务,与用户直接交互。传输层主要负责端到端的数据传输,TCP和UDP是该层的主要协议。网络层则处理IP地址和路由选择,而数据链路层负责物理介质上的数据帧传输。
在OSI参考模型中,TCP/IP协议栈的各层与之对应:应用层对应OSI的应用层、表示层和会话层;传输层对应OSI的传输层;网络层对应OSI的网络层;数据链路层和物理层则对应OSI的相应层。TCP/IP协议栈比OSI模型更简洁,更适用于实际网络环境。
IP地址是网络中的节点身份标识,分为A、B、C、D、E五类。通常我们使用的是IPv4地址,由32位二进制组成,通常用点分十进制表示。子网规划是将大的IP网络划分为多个小的子网,以优化路由和提高网络管理效率。这涉及到子网掩码、网络地址、广播地址的计算以及CIDR(无类别域间路由)等概念。
课程内容涵盖了TCP/IP协议的基本原理,包括TCP/IP协议栈的各个层次及其功能,如TCP的连接建立和释放机制、IP地址的分类和子网划分。通过学习,学员应能理解和应用这些知识,解决实际网络问题。此外,还介绍了传输层的TCP和UDP协议,以及它们在端口通信中的作用,端口号用于区分不同应用层的服务。
TCP/IP协议是互联网的核心,它的连接建立过程保证了数据的可靠传输。而子网规划则是网络管理的重要环节,有助于优化网络性能。通过深入理解TCP/IP协议原理和子网规划,可以更好地设计和维护网络系统。
2018-09-27 上传
2008-12-22 上传
2022-09-06 上传
2021-05-24 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
鲁严波
- 粉丝: 25
- 资源: 2万+
最新资源
- 诺基亚N78使用说明书
- 单片机与计算机RS-232串行通信开发实例
- USB 2.0 规范.pdf
- 教你如何使用jsp生成彩色汉字验证码的源码
- sd卡规范书.pdf
- playfair java实现
- Mathematica 5.0简明教程(中文版)
- 主板知识,有关电脑主板的详细介绍
- c#自学过程。想学c#的一定要看啊!
- 一步一步基于ARMSYS在ADS1.2开发环境下进行开发.pdf
- iis+php+mysql+phpmyadmin建站流程
- 24c02中文资料24c02串行储存器中文官方资料手册
- 从C&C++过渡到Objective-C
- 封装c#的源程序变成一个EXE或MSI安装包
- 西門子摸擬量的纊程事例
- j2ee mvc面试题下载